So 2nd request for help in one day (doh I feel like a tosser), I am attempting an oil change.
I have removed the drain plug and started to drain the oil, tried to undo the filter, its stuck fast!! I Know its anti clockwise to turn the thing but it wont budge and the ratchet it starting to deform the filter. Any advise as 1. its stuck fast and 2. access is a right bitch to turn anything anti clockwise.

Stab it with a screw driver and that gives you something to hold on while you unscrew that mo'fo

screwdriver will give you more leverage, once it moves, remove screwdriver and it will then turn by hand

Just as Nitin said, nice BIG screwdriver right through it (near the end though! Not too close to the block). Gives you a nice amount of leverage

Beware though, oil will drip down the screwdriver!
What tool are you using to turn it? I got hold of a metal loop thing that you turn a screw to tighten instead of the old material one, I found that much better.

Remember to do the new one up only hand tight, so that next time it's nice and easy to get off!!
